About

The first Uncanny live stage show I Know What I Saw was one of the best-selling paranormal shows in theatre history.

Now, Danny Robins and his team of experts are back with a brand-new show for 2025, with even more terrifying real-life stories and witness accounts that will have you gripped from the very beginning. 

This is NOT an ordinary podcast show. This is story-telling and paranormal investigation at its peak. Using a unique mix of sound, projection and stagecraft, recollections of hauntings, apparitions and events that seem to defy logical explanation are examined by Danny, Ciarán O’ Keeffe and Evelyn Hollow, with input from you, the audience, as you get the chance to share your theories and your own experiences. 

As always, whether you are team sceptic, team believer or somewhere in between, everyone is welcome. 

The only question to ask before you come is: do you have a fear of the dark?

Age guidance - 16+
